1. Focus Comes First
A strong DIFC steakhouse knows what it is built to do. Steak should not feel like just another item on a long menu. It should be the foundation of the kitchen. Restaurants that treat steak as the main event tend to deliver better consistency, clearer menus, and more confidence on the plate.
This is often the first sign that you are in the right place. When the menu feels focused, the experience usually follows.
2. Consistency Matters More Than Variety
When people talk about the best steakhouse in DIFC, they are rarely talking about the most experimental one. They are talking about the place they can return to without hesitation. Consistency is what builds that trust.
A reliable steakhouse delivers the same standard every visit. The steak is cooked properly, the sides make sense, and the experience feels familiar in the best way. That reliability is what turns first-time guests into regulars.
3. Simplicity Is a Strength
Great steakhouses do not overcomplicate things. The best ones understand that steak does not need constant reinvention to stay interesting. Clean execution, classic pairings, and attention to detail often matter more than elaborate presentation.

4. The Experience Should Fit the Moment
The right steakhouse in DIFC should work across different occasions. Sometimes it is a business lunch. Other times it is an unhurried dinner or a spontaneous decision at the end of the day. The atmosphere should feel adaptable, not locked into one specific mood.
Steakhouses that understand this tend to become part of people’s regular routines rather than one off destinations.
5. Reputation Is Built Over Time
In a district with many dining options, reputation matters. A steakhouse earns its place by delivering quality repeatedly, not by relying on short-term hype.
